Lead capture

An answer can do more than inform, it can capture. Add an inline email form to any answer, so a visitor who just watched you explain pricing can leave their details without ever leaving the page. Lead capture is a Pro feature.

Add it to an answer

  1. Open a question in the editor and add a button.
  2. Choose the Lead capture button type.
  3. Set the label (for example "Get in touch") and which fields to collect (email is required; name, phone and a message are optional).
  4. Set the thank-you message shown after submit.

Where leads go

Submissions land in the Leads screen in your dashboard, with the question they came from, the page, and the time. You get an email notification for each new lead, and you can export everything to CSV.

Cookieless and private

Lead capture is first-party and consent-clean, the visitor explicitly submits their details. The widget itself sets no cookies and no tracking identifiers.
